Artists work in an intensive small-group setting to refine project ideas better articulate the central concerns of their practice deepen the conceptual grounding of the work and situate their practice within a wider art world context. The Center Program is the Art Centers answer to critical gaps in traditional professional development programs allowing working artists access to space to develop studio practice inclusion in critical dialogues guidance from professionals in the field and a platform to show new works to a broader diverse audience.
